The Cuban National Series (Spanish: Serie Nacional de Béisbol, SNB) is a domestic baseball competition in Cuba.Formed after the dissolution of the Cuban League in the wake of the Cuban Revolution, the National Series is a part of the Cuban baseball league system.
The 2022 Cuban National Series was the 61st season of the league. [1] This was the first season that the league did not play a schedule spanning two calendar years, as the regular season began on 23 January and ended on 22 May. [2] In the series' final round, contested in June, Granma defeated Matanzas in a rematch of the prior season's final. [3]
The 2023 Cuban National Series was the 62nd season of the league. [1] No longer playing a winter league schedule, the regular season began on 29 March and ended on 3 July. [ 2 ] In the series' final playoff round, contested in August, Las Tunas defeated Industriales in a four-game sweep.

The 2012–13 Cuban National Series was the 52nd season of the league. [1] Villa Clara defeated Matanzas in the series' final round. [2]The season involved a pause of approximately eight weeks, to allow players of the Cuba national baseball team to participate in the 2013 World Baseball Classic.

The 46th season of the Cuban National Series saw perennial powers Industriales and Santiago de Cuba meet in the playoff final, where the Avispas won the title, 4-2.. Pinar del Río and Santiago had the best regular season records, but the Vegueros were upset by La Habana in the first round of the playoffs.
The 2016–17 Cuban National Series was the 56th season of the league. [1] Granma defeated Ciego de Ávila in the series' final round, in a four-game sweep. [2] This season marked a few format changes for the Cuban National Series. The amount of teams in the second phase was lowered to six from eight.
